The following is the content to share:


1. Inventory update: Warehouse colleagues will report yesterday's inventory status, including purchase quantity, sales quantity and current inventory level. This can help other teams understand which products are fully stocked and which products may need to be restocked.

2. Warehousing efficiency: Warehousing colleagues will share efficiency indicators of warehouse operations, such as order processing speed, cargo loading and unloading speed, etc. They may suggest any potential improvements to make the warehouse more efficient and ensure orders are delivered on time.

3. Problems and challenges: Warehousing colleagues will mention any problems or challenges they encounter, such as logistics delays, damaged goods, or difficulties with inventory management. This allows other teams to understand potential risks and assist in resolving them.

4. Logistics updates: Warehousing colleagues will share the latest information about logistics, such as service updates from transportation partners, changes in freight rates, or adjustments to transportation time limits. This information is critical for both sales and customer service teams.

5. Safety and Compliance: Warehousing colleagues will emphasize the importance of warehouse safety and compliance and share any relevant training or updates. This includes the latest requirements for packaging, marking and handling of goods to ensure compliance with international trade standards.
